In short

WiseEHR is a WiseTREND plugin that automates ingestion of inbound clinical documents — medical records, referrals, lab reports, and patient-intake packets — into electronic health record systems. It classifies each document, extracts structured fields and metadata, and routes the result into Epic, Cerner, or other EHR platforms via HL7/FHIR.

Key capabilities

  • Document classification. Sorts faxed and scanned clinical documents by type for the right chart location.
  • Structured extraction. Patient demographics, dates, providers, and clinical fields.
  • HL7 / FHIR delivery. Delivers data and documents into the EHR via standard healthcare interfaces.
  • Intake automation. Captures patient-intake packets including demographics, consent, and insurance cards.

How does WiseEHR get data into our EHR?

Via standard healthcare interfaces — HL7 (e.g., ORU) and FHIR — plus file-based batch options where preferred.

Does it handle faxed records?

Yes. Faxed and scanned records are classified, extracted, and routed without manual indexing.
